This Friday, January 14, is the cutest holiday of the year—National Dress Up Your Pet Day! We’re taking this holiday as an open invitation to dress up our furry and feathered friends and take the most adorable photos.

But, before you get snapping, be sure you know how to dress up your pet safely. This means: 

  • No dangling, loose parts or headpieces. Check for small, dangling or easily chewed-off pieces before dressing your pet.
  • Your pet’s movement, sight or ability to breathe, bark or meow should not be limited.
  • If your pet seems distressed or shows abnormal behavior, a bandana or bowtie may be your best bet.
  • Avoid overly large/small costumes as they can present safety issues.
